  1. This site is a plug for Kraken, Misunderstands Prime

    The lowest trading volume tier is $1M-$20M a month -- totally different league. Also the fees start at .18% for takers and .08% for makers, quickly going down to near zero for institutions with large AUMs. Prime routes orders dynamically for optimal execution, including fees, so the largely made up notion that Coinbase is not competitive on fees is once again so far off, the reality is the opposite this time: prime is a highly competitive product for an important investor class from a trusted company in a space most institutional investors find confusing and perceive as somewhat dodgy. Are there other firms out there with the crypto nous and, crucially, the size to offer comparable products? This page about Kraken sounds great for individual/retail investors, though Coinbase Pro is competitive (but Coinbase isn't), but Prime should not be reviewed here. There's no comparing those kinds of trading services with those provided for retail clients.

9 Best Cryptocurrency Payment Gateways Reviewed [January 2023]
BitPay is one of the early crypto payment gateway platforms to offer crypto payment services to businesses. Its primary feature is, it protects users from the volatility of cryptocurrencies. When the transaction gets initiated, BitPay locks in the exchange rate so that the receiver gets the exact value of the deposit. It also has customizable settings for payouts.

11 Best Crypto APIs for Developers
BitPay is a Bitcoin and cryptocurrency payment processor that enables merchants and consumers to instantly accept cryptocurrency as payment without risk or price fluctuations. Currently, credit cards can charge up to 3% in processing fees on every transaction. Compared to credit cards, BitPay only charges a flat 1% settlement fee for crypto-to-fiat bank conversion....
